About The Position

Extend is revolutionizing the post-purchase experience for retailers and their customers by providing merchants with AI-driven solutions that enhance customer satisfaction and drive revenue growth. Our comprehensive platform offers automated customer service handling, seamless returns/exchange management, end-to-end automated fulfillment, and product protection and shipping protection alongside Extend's best-in-class fraud detection. By integrating leading-edge technology with exceptional customer service, Extend empowers businesses to build trust and loyalty among consumers while reducing costs and increasing profits. Today, Extend works with more than 1,000 leading merchant partners across industries, including fashion/apparel, cosmetics, furniture, jewelry, consumer electronics, auto parts, sports and fitness, and much more. Extend is backed by some of the most prominent technology investors in the industry, and our headquarters is in downtown San Francisco. We're looking for an Analyst to join our Client Insights team and play a key role in how we use data to protect and empower our merchant partners. You'll sit at the intersection of analytics, product, strategy, sales, and merchant success; the models, reporting, and insights created and owned by this individual will have a direct impact on sales and merchant retention. Our team is helping build the next-generation of AI-driven post-purchase customer solutions and this role will be instrumental in driving the success of these solutions. This is a high-impact role for someone who's curious, detail-oriented, and excited about turning data into action.

Requirements

  • 2–4 years of experience in an analytics, data science, or business intelligence role
  • Strong proficiency in SQL — you're comfortable querying large datasets, writing clean, efficient code, and understanding optimal data modeling
  • Experience building and maintaining transformation code in dbt
  • Experience with Snowflake
  • Familiarity with Tableau
  • A self-starter mindset: you ask good questions, dig into problems independently, and know when to loop others in

Nice To Haves

  • Understanding of consumer brands, ecommerce, and important metrics and benchmarks in the industry is a plus
  • Knowledge of Python is a plus — experience using it for data manipulation or automation is a bonus

Responsibilities

  • Build clean and efficient data models out of messy and unstructured data; create pipelines that support internal and external reporting
  • Develop and own merchant-facing reporting models and data visualizations that communicate performance clearly and compellingly
  • Work closely with data engineering and product teams to stay aligned on underlying data changes and surface opportunities for improvement
  • Partner cross-functionally with the Risk and Data (RAD) team to help build new fraud analysis and translate that analysis into easy-to-understand reporting; stay current on model and product changes, and translate those changes into merchant-facing insights
  • Contribute to building a more scalable, sophisticated reporting pipeline over time
